What Is Boost-Store?

Boost-Store operates as a dedicated boosting platform focused on a narrow selection of titles. It provides services such as ELO boosting, power leveling, ratings, and coaching through its own team of boosters. The site maintains fixed pricing tiers between $10 and $100, with an overall rating of 4.1/5. Because it is not a marketplace, every order is handled under a single operational standard rather than relying on third-party sellers.

What Is G2G?

G2G functions as a peer-to-peer marketplace where independent sellers list game-related services, including boosting and power leveling. Buyers can browse offers across many more titles and compare prices from multiple providers. The platform includes built-in buyer protection and visible seller ratings, allowing users to filter offers based on feedback and completion history.

Pricing Comparison

Boost-Store uses a fixed-price model. Customers know the exact cost upfront for each package, which reduces uncertainty but may limit options for finding lower rates. G2Gโ€™s marketplace structure creates price competition among sellers, which frequently results in lower offers for the same service. However, the lowest-priced listings sometimes come from newer or less-reviewed sellers, introducing variability in quality. For budget-conscious buyers willing to compare multiple offers, G2G can deliver better value; for those who prefer predictable costs without negotiation, Boost-Storeโ€™s model is simpler.

Games & Services

Boost-Store concentrates on League of Legends, Dota 2, and World of Warcraft, offering targeted boosting, power leveling, and coaching within those ecosystems. This specialization allows the service to maintain focused expertise but leaves users of other titles without options. G2G supports a much broader catalog, including Valorant, Final Fantasy XIV, Diablo 4, Elder Scrolls Online, and RuneScape. Its service range also extends beyond boosting to include currency, items, and accounts. Players seeking services outside Boost-Storeโ€™s three titles will naturally gravitate toward G2G.

Safety & Trust

Safety considerations differ significantly. Boost-Store assumes responsibility for the entire transaction as a direct service provider, which can reduce the risk of dealing with unreliable individuals. G2G provides an explicit buyer protection policy and public seller ratings that let customers assess risk before purchasing. Both approaches carry the inherent risks associated with account sharing in competitive games; neither platform can eliminate the possibility of account penalties from game publishers. G2Gโ€™s rating system gives buyers more granular information, while Boost-Store offers a single, uniform trust layer.

Customer Support

Boost-Store provides centralized support channels managed by the company itself. Customers interact with one support team throughout the order lifecycle. G2G routes support through a combination of platform tickets and direct communication with the chosen seller. Response times on G2G can vary depending on the sellerโ€™s availability, whereas Boost-Storeโ€™s support operates under a single service-level expectation. Buyers who value consistent communication may prefer Boost-Store; those comfortable managing seller interactions may find G2G adequate.

Who Should Choose Which?

Players who need boosting only for League of Legends, Dota 2, or World of Warcraft and prefer a single point of contact with predictable costs tend to favor Boost-Store. Users seeking services for additional games, or those who want to compare multiple price points and seller histories, generally find G2G more suitable. Neither platform is universally superior; the choice depends on the specific game, budget flexibility, and tolerance for variability in service delivery.
